Explanation
The nucleus, which contains protons and neutrons, holds almost all of the atom’s mass.
Common mistake
Nucleus Size Misconception
Students often describe the nucleus as being large compared to the entire atom.
Emphasize that the nucleus is actually very small compared to the overall size of the atom, which is mostly empty space.
